- 相關推薦
職稱計算機考試Dreamwaver中表單的創建與應用
表單在網頁中主要負責數據采集功能。下面小編給大家講述的是職稱計算機考試Dreamwaver中表單的創建與應用,大家可以參考閱讀,更多詳情請關注應屆畢業生考試網。
創建表單
在Dreamweaver中可以創建各種各樣的表單,表單中可以包含各種對象,例如文本域、按鈕、列表等。
1、插入表單
在網頁中添加表單對象,首先必須創建表單。表單在瀏覽網頁中屬于不可見元素。在Dreamweaver8中插入一個表單。當頁面處于“設計”視圖中時,用紅色的虛輪廓線指示表單。如果沒有看到此輪廓線,請檢查是否選中了“查看”>“可視化助理”>“不可見元素”。
(1)將插入點放在希望表單出現的位置。選擇“插入”>“表單”,或選擇“插入”欄上的“表單”類別,然后單擊“表單”圖標,
(2)用鼠標選中表單,在屬性面板上可以設置表單的各項屬性。
在“動作”文本框中指定處理該表單的動態也或腳本的路徑。
在“方法”下拉列表中,選擇將表單數據傳輸到服務器的方法。表單“方法”有:
POST 在 HTTP 請求中嵌入表單數據。GET 將值追加到請求該頁的 URL 中。默認 使用瀏覽器的默認設置將表單數據發送到服務器。通常,默認方法為 GET 方法。不要使用 GET 方法發送長表單。URL 的長度限制在 8,192 個字符以內。如果發送的數據量太大,數據將被截斷,從而導致意外的或失敗的處理結果。而且,在發送機密用戶名和密碼、信用卡號或其他機密信息時,不要使用 GET 方法。用 GET 方法傳遞信息不安全。
在“目標”彈出式菜單指定一個窗口,在該窗口中顯示調用程序所返回的數據。如果命名的窗口尚未打開,則打開一個具有該名稱的新窗口。目標值有: _blank,在未命名的`新窗口中打開目標文檔。 _parent,在顯示當前文檔的窗口的父窗口中打開目標文檔。 _self,在提交表單所使用的窗口中打開目標文檔。 _top,在當前窗口的窗體內打開目標文檔。此值可用于確保目標文檔占用整個窗口,即使原始文檔顯示在框架中。
表單的應用
1、一個簡單的提交留言頁面
新建11.html網頁文件,選擇表單插入欄,插入表單,將光標放置在表單內,插入一個5行2列的表格,將第1、5行合并。分別在第2、3行插入文本字段,在第4行插入文本區域,在第5行插入兩個按鈕。
文本域是用戶在其中輸入響應的表單對象。有三種類型的文本域:
單行文本域通常提供單字或短語響應,如姓名或地址。
多行文本域為訪問者提供一個較大的區域,供其輸入響應。可以指定訪問者最多可輸入的行數以及對象的字符寬度。如果輸入的文本超過這些設置,則該域將按照換行屬性中指定的設置進行滾動。
密碼域是特殊類型的文本域。當用戶在密碼域中鍵入時,所輸入的文本被替換為星號或項目符號,以隱藏該文本,保護這些信息不被看到。
頁面布局效果如下:
2、制作網頁跳轉菜單
打開一個建立好的網頁文件,把鼠標的光標放置在需要插入跳轉菜單的.位置。選擇表單插入欄中的“跳轉菜單”命令,在網頁中插入一個跳轉菜單。
在彈出的“跳轉菜單”對話框中,根據提示輸入相應內容:
點擊確定,按F12預覽效果。
3、運行代碼實例
新建文件12.html。
打開12.html,插入表單,在表單中插入一個文本區域,在回車,再插入一個按鈕。
選中文本區域,在屬性面板中,設置文本區域的文本寬度為50,行數為8。
選中按鈕,在屬性面板中,將按鈕的值設為“運行代碼”。
選中form表單,在屬性面板中,單擊動作文本框旁的“瀏覽按鈕”,選擇指向13.html,目標選擇_blank。
在11.html的代碼區復制整個代碼,在打開12.html文件,在設計視圖中選中文本區域,轉到代碼區,將光標放置在<textarea name="textarea" cols="50" rows="8"></textarea>的“><”之間,按住Ctrl+V粘貼11.html頁面的代碼。 保存后,按F12預覽。
認識表單對象
使用表單,可以幫助Internet服務器從用戶那里收集信息,例如收集用戶資料、獲取用戶訂單,在Internet上統也同樣存在大量的表單,讓用戶輸入文字進行選擇。
1、通常表單的工作過程如下:
(1)訪問者在瀏覽有表單的頁面時,可填寫必要的信息,然后單擊“提交”按鈕。
(2)這些信息通過Internet傳送到服務器上。
(3)服務器上專門的程序對這些數據進行處理,如果有錯誤會返回錯誤信息,并要求糾正錯誤。
(4)當數據完整無誤后,服務器反饋一個輸入完成信息。
2、一個完整的表單包含兩個部分:
(1)一個是在網頁中進行描述的'表單對象。
(2)二是應用程序,它可以是服務器端的,也可以是客戶端的,用于對客戶信息進行分析處理。
二、認識表單對象
在 Dreamweaver 中,表單輸入類型稱為表單對象。可以通過選擇“插入”>“表單對象”來插入表單對象,或者通過從下圖顯示的“插入”欄的“表單”面板訪問表單對象來插入表單對象。
1、表單
“表單”在文檔中插入表單。任何其他表單對象,如文本域、按鈕等,都必須插入表單之中,這樣所有瀏覽器才能正確處理這些數據。
2、文本域
“文本域”在表單中插入文本域。文本域可接受任何類型的字母數字項。輸入的文本可以顯示為單行、多行或者顯示為項目符號或星號(用于保護密碼)。
3、復選框
“復選框”在表單中插入復選框。復選框允許在一組選項中選擇多項,用戶可以選擇任意多個適用的選項。
4、單選按鈕
“單選按鈕”在表單中插入單選按鈕。單選按鈕代表互相排斥的選擇。選擇一組中的某個按鈕,就會取消選擇該組中的所有其他按鈕。例如,用戶可以選擇“是”或“否”。
5、單選按鈕組
“單選按鈕組”插入共享同一名稱的單選按鈕的集合。
6、列表/菜單
“列表/菜單”使您可以在列表中創建用戶選項。“列表”選項在滾動列表中顯示選項值,并允許用戶在列表中選擇多個選項。“菜單”選項在彈出式菜單中顯示選項值,而且只允許用戶選擇一個選項。
7、跳轉菜單
“跳轉菜單”插入可導航的列表或彈出式菜單。跳轉菜單允許您插入一種菜單,在這種菜單中的每個選項都鏈接到文檔或文件。請參見創建跳轉菜單。
8、圖像域
“圖像域”使您可以在表單中插入圖像。可以使用圖像域替換“提交”按鈕,以生成圖形化按鈕。
9、文件域
“文件域”在文檔中插入空白文本域和“瀏覽”按鈕。文件域使用戶可以瀏覽到其硬盤上的文件,并將這些文件作為表單數據上傳。
10、按鈕
“按鈕”在表單中插入文本按鈕。按鈕在單擊時執行任務,如提交或重置表單。可以為按鈕添加自定義名稱或標簽,或者使用預定義的“提交”或“重置”標簽之一。
11、標簽
“標簽”在文檔中給表單加上標簽,以形式開頭和結尾。
12、字段集
“字段集”在文本中設置文本標簽。
認識了表單,那么創建和使用表單時就可以根據需要進行選擇。表單時動態網頁的靈魂。
【職稱計算機考試Dreamwaver中表單的創建與應用】相關文章:
職稱計算機考試知識考點:計算機的應用03-30
職稱計算機考試中WPS的技巧使用12-07